Well, if you follow a walkthrough to the letter you aren't learning that much. It is better if you think about the whole picture. Think about why the author of the walkthrough is doing what he or she did. This allows you to see flaws or openings where you can add other strategies to the walkthrough. This can help make you a more independent player so you won't need people to hold your hand later on in gaming.

I'll tell you a story about cheating.

I once wrote a good trainer for AoE 2, that avoided the OOS (Out of Synch) error, by acting like this - in-game cheat codes were on for you, off for enemy. People didn't believe me, as trainers were dealt with, so I started a few games with some friends I played with, and I came over them with huge hordes of units, by cheating.

Then, I was asked to show it to the world, proving it's actually so, and even release the source (!). I refused. I said that I don't want it to be in hands of some bastards spoiling the fun, and then many appreciated my decision. Recorded games were there as a proof, though.

Soon there came out another AoE 2 hack, not by me, proving that I did actually do my trainer.

Just a story...
